§ 35-3-113 — Annual oversight of accounts; information to be shown; powers and duties of director
(a)The director of the state department of audit shall
cause there to be oversight of the books of account, kept by the
board of trustees of each sanitary and improvement district in
the state of Wyoming, in accordance with W.S. 9-1-507 or
16-4-121(f), as applicable.
